Transaction e31a5f2ef370a83b6ece1d9257308acce6bf053474b9608f3dfdfefe981e998a
1 Input
1 Output
-
e31a5f2ef370a83b6ece1d9257308acce6bf053474b9608f3dfdfefe981e998a:0
- value
- 17411
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ddd438efa075dd382469e8caabf57fff5f9915c94926cbfb1c54b03a91e2c96e
- address
- bc1pmh2r3maqwhwnsfrfar92hatlla0ej9wffynvh7cu2jcr4y0ze9hqlyuvph